Verdict

A market move for Tony Martin's La Carihuela would undoubtedly be of interest in this handicap hurdle but she has yet to even be placed in 13 starts so looks best watched and preference is for Lady Roania, who gets the vote ahead of Little Bit of Hush. The last mentioned made a winning start to his career when landing a Haydock bumper in April 2006 but has failed to progress from that in just four starts since then. However, Noel Chance's gelding ran better last time and has to be respected. Le Forezien has more to do than when landing a selling hurdle at Hereford last month, while Seven Is Lucky looks to be going the right way after an improved effort at Hexham last time but needs to improve again. Flying Doctor has run consistently well in his last two starts and should again be thereabouts but a better bet looks to be Lady Roania, who has no problems with trip or ground and is on a fair enough mark in this company.
